Transaction 2c80c36281558635609c554f8b27e32d6b226774f8231caefa407ac2932fc724
1 Input
1 Output
-
2c80c36281558635609c554f8b27e32d6b226774f8231caefa407ac2932fc724:0
- value
- 10354389
- script pubkey
- OP_0 OP_PUSHBYTES_20 38f8537100083646445ee3e1456f73886be1eb38
- address
- bc1q8ru9xugqpqmyv3z7u0s52mmn3p47r6ecuu93wl